The Sariaya Tourism Council (STC) launched its Lenten
production “SANTO KRISTO: ISANG SENAKULO” via a small gathering at the Dona
Concha Subdivision residence of STC Treasurer Ma. Teresa Cuello-Baligod on the
evening of February , 2008. Present on the occasion were the members of the STC
Dramatic Guild and five new recruits from the St. Francis High School, as well
as Senakulo Director Mr. Federico Ceribo, Sariaya Institute Teacher Ms. Jenny Salumbides, Designer Christopher
Quejano, Make up artist Janice Martinez, together with STC representatives
Brgy. 6 Councilor JR de Gracia, Mrs. Baligod herself and Mr. Eric J. Dedace.
They talked about the necessary preparations for the forthcoming street play to
be staged in selected town thoroughfares on Holy Wednesday, March 19, 2008, a
regular feature of the Sariaya Lenten season scene ever since it started in
2006.
In reality, the preparations started even earlier, in the
afternoon of January 11, 2008, when Mrs.
Baligod, Mr. Dedace, Mr. Quejano and his assistant drove for the Cuello Family
Compound at Sitio Loob, Barangay Bignay I, where the Senakulo costumes are
being kept. They did an inventory and sorted out which of them need to be
repaired and altered to suit the production requirements. These costumes were then
brought to the Quejano Boutique for the purpose.
